Output 53e5cb891624b1b69ce3aba04b452eacf73b146a6629a008b1b3428f1b55b40e:2

value
546810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d46418490d8b1bb836a1afcfcae787e357dcf52b OP_EQUAL
address
3M435vbhtYM9jW3FaT4x9BLzY5EdCShsNe
transaction
53e5cb891624b1b69ce3aba04b452eacf73b146a6629a008b1b3428f1b55b40e
spent
true